Associate Media Planner assists the media department with cross-channel media planning and buying. The Associate actively participates in all necessary training modules and supports the media team with day-to-day tasks and financial maintenance. Responsible for status reporting, traffic sheets, financials, research, planning/buying assistance, and relationship building internally and with outside partners. The goal for the role is to learn and apply basic media principles.

Key Responsibilities

Knowledge

· Knows how the agency works and how jobs flow through the agency

· Has broad but basic knowledge of the brands, category, channels & processes

· Competency in media math, financial terminology, publisher T&Cs

· Gain understanding of online campaign management trafficking/ad serving systems, media technologies including MediaVisor and traffic sheets through taking appropriate trainings and meeting with Power Users and MOTs

· Basic knowledge of media tools: @Plan, Ad Relevance, SDS, Benchtools, ComScore, etc.

· Basic knowledge and assistance in media planning and buying process

· Develop strong financial management skills through actualization, UMB/IRR, and Workflow training

· Seeks to understand the project strategy and gain competitive knowledge. Understands media goals, objectives & strategies for ad campaign.

Internal: Operations, Tactics and Strategy

· Diligently and flawlessly executes on assigned area of project

· Manages weekly media delivery reports

· Core responsibilities include financial management systems:

· Checks Workflow on a weekly basis and reconciles invoices

· Independently completes monthly actualizations, pulls and checks grids, and develops client memos

· Quantifies all negotiated savings by comparing to partner rate cards

· Manages the development and updates to traffic sheets with minimal supervision and error

· Shares interesting learning's/articles relevant to the media team/brands

· Ability to review, understand, and take appropriate actions with UMB/IRR

· Ownership of the organization and appropriate documentation of team binder(s)

· Works with Media Technology on QC of campaigns and ensures appropriate compliance measures met.

· Assists in data and consumer profile gathering

· Assists with flighting, uploading media buys

· Researches media placement options

· Executes media planning & buying

· Manages contract process

Client Relationship

· Highly responsive, timely and effective at meeting client requests

· Understands clients’ business

· Detailed, professional and timely communications to internal team, vendor partners, and management of team status report.

· Begins to build rapport with media team members internal clients (cross-capability)

· Liaison between AP and outside media vendors regarding invoicing and financials

· Begins to participate in client/vendor calls – can knowledgably articulate project status to clients

· Begins to build rapport with clients and outside vendors

· Begins to learn basic client/vendor management techniques (how to document client feedback, how to recognize when to pushback, etc.)

· Manages vendor contact list

· Day-to-day resource for media vendors, “go-to person” and escalates vendor difficulties appropriately.

· Vendor communication of project needs
